Windows性能计数器(用于监控系统和sql server)

本文介绍了如何通过Windows性能计数器监控系统和SQL Server,包括如何保存性能数据为二进制和文本文件,如何将日志直接保存到数据库中,以及配置和解释各种监控项,如CPU使用率、IO等待、磁盘性能等。
摘要由CSDN通过智能技术生成

Windows性能计数器(用于监控系统和sql server)

进入:单击开始,单击运行,键入 perfmon,然后按 ENTER 键或单击确定,进入性能控制台。这里包括系统监视器(系统计时器实时监控)、性能和警报(计数日志、跟踪日志、警报)。

 1、保存为二进制文

     可通过命令 relog 将二进制文件转化为格式的文件。具体 relog /?查看。

2、保存为带间隔符的文本文件

      这个可直接查看,也可导入到数据。导入脚本如下:

     select * into Perflog from OPENROWSET('MICROSOFT.JET.OLEDB.4.0','Text;HDR=NO;DATABASE=c:/perflogs/',counters#CSV)

3、日志直接保存到数据库中

创建数据源名称 (DSN)

1. 单击开始,指向设置,单击控制面板,然后双击管理工具。

2. 双击数据源 (ODBC),单击系统 DSN 选项卡,然后单击添加。

3. 双击SQLServer,为该 DSN 键入名称。

4. 单击运行数据库所在的SQLServer 的计算机,然后单击下一步。

5. 单击使用网络登录 ID Windows NT 身份验证,然后单击下一步。

6. 更改默认的数据库为你保存日志的数据库。

7. 单击确定接受默认设置,然后单击完成。

8. 单击数据源,成功。

日志配置

1.  选择“性能日志和警报计数器日志”,右键单击“计数器日志”,然后单击新建日志设置

2.  为该日志键入一个名称,然后单击确定。

3.  单击添加对象添加要记录的对象,然后单击添加。

4.  输入要监视的计数器,然后单击关闭。

5.  单击日志文件选项卡,在日志文件类型列表中单击SQL数据库,然后单击配置。

6.  在系统 DSN 框中,单击要连接到的 DSN。如果要重命名该日志组,则在日志组名称框中键入新名称。

7.  单击确定,然后单击应用。

此时启动新建的日志,会提示无法启动,需要进行如下设置:日志属性常规选项卡中,运行方式需要进行设定,设置上用户名、密码。(该用户必须同时属于用户组“Performance Log Users”和“SQLServerMSSQLUser$主机名$MSSQLSERVER”, 或者直接属于administrators)

  • 0
    点赞
  • 6
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值